前端动画那些事
1.何为动画
前端动画的基础概念
- 帧
- 帧率
- 帧时长
- 浏览器的刷新率
- 硬件加速
2.动画的载体
前端动画的一个误区
- 前端绘图技术
- GIF动画
- SVG动画
- Canvas动画
- WebGL动画
- 前端动画技术
- CSS动画
- JavaScript动画
3.控制你的动画
4.动手实践
使用Git + VSCode让开发体验更顺畅
1.Git基本使用和工作流规范
2.VSCode开发调试和插件扩展
3.未来可期的云上IDE
如何打造前端的核心竞争力
1.什么是前端工程师
-
是什么?
WEB Front-End Developer
-
发展历程 1.0-2.0
- WEB 2.0
- RIA之争
- 标准的胜利:HTML5
-
做什么?门户、地图、小游戏、小程序......
2.前端工程师所面临的挑战
-
兼容性/性能
- IE一家独大
- DOM API标准割裂
- ES3还是主流,ES5支持差
- CSS3遥遥无期
-
模块化 /依赖管理
- JavaScript缺少模块管理机制
- 全局变量盛行
-
工程化
-
框架
-
今天:永恒的主题
- 跨端
- 性能
- 效率
- 质量
- 安全
3.前端工程师的核心竞争力
核心竞争力
- 熟练掌握前端技能 -- 高效、高质量工作
- 扎实的专业基础 -- 具备成长潜力
- 深入理解领域知识 -- 行业专家
- 快速学习能力 -- 应对变化
- 良好的沟通能力 -- 团队协作
- 积极进取有担当 -- 你办事我放心
求职招聘季,如何斩获大厂的Offer
1.面试前:
抹平知识树
- JS
- HTML
- CSS
- 框架
- 计算机网络
- 浏览器
- 算法
- 数据结构
- Git
前端知识获取途径
-
一些前端技术网站
IVWEB、掘金、知乎、思否
-
一些前端大牛博客/公众号
- 程序员小卡
- 阮一峰
- 小胡子哥
- 张鑫旭
2.面试中:
面试技巧:
-
加分项
- 项目经验
- 实习经验
- 博客
- 算法
- 源码
- 知识面
- 语言表达
- 自信
- ......
-
问一些他们团队的技术项
3.面试后:
沉淀和总结
- 文章输出
- 查漏补缺
- 反思